SYN x The Attitude Foundation presents: Emerging Voices. The Emerging Voices work experience program provides a platform for people with disability to write and produce media content, creating a more accessible opportunity for people with disability to gain further training and experience in their chosen area of media. Each round invites 10 new participants to share their stories and add their voice to the community radio space here at SYN. All episodes are produced, hosted and curated by Emerging Voices participants. If you would like to get involved in the program email community@syn.org.au or attitude@attitude.org.au.
